CPR for babies and youngsters, discussed clearly
Cardiac apprehension in kids is unusual, but when it takes place, it often starts with breathing problems instead of a heart rhythm problem. That alters exactly how we prioritise our activities. Oxygen issues initially, compressions right behind it, and three-way absolutely no is never ever much from your lips. When I teach a CPR program in Campbelltown, I concentrate on getting the basics best whenever, not memorising jargon.
For infants as much as one year: make use of 2 fingers in the centre of the chest, compress about one third of chest deepness at a rhythm near 100 to 120 per min. After 30 compressions, provide 2 gentle breaths, simply enough to see the breast rise. Keep the head in a neutral position. Too much head tilt can block the respiratory tract in babies.

For children from one year to the age of puberty: utilize one hand or two depending upon size, once more to a depth of about one third of the breast, same rhythm, 30 compressions and 2 breaths. If you are alone and did not witness the collapse, do about 2 minutes of CPR before delegating call three-way zero, unless you have a mobile on audio speaker and can do both.
What regarding AEDs? Modern defibrillators are safe for youngsters. Use pediatric pads if offered, one on the chest and one on the back. So grown-up pads get on hand, use them and location to prevent overlap. An AED will not shock a youngster unless it spots a shockable rhythm, so you won't unintentionally trigger damage by applying it.

Choking: the silent emergency
For choking, silence is a lot more telling than coughings. If a child can speak or cough, encourage coughing and watch carefully. If they can not breathe, cough, or make sound, act immediately.
Infants under one year: sustain the head and neck, angle the infant slightly down throughout your forearm, provide company back impacts in between the shoulder blades. If still obstructed, transform the baby face up and give breast thrusts with two fingers on the breastbone. Alternate back blows and chest drives while you or someone else calls triple zero.
Children over one: support the child, a little to the side, and supply sharp back strikes. If ineffective, do abdominal thrusts, drawing inward and upward above the navel. Alternating till the item clears or the youngster comes to be less competent, then begin mouth-to-mouth resuscitation. After any kind of significant choking episode, also if every little thing appears fine, see a doctor, because little airway swelling can construct after the event.
One crucial point: never ever thoughtlessly sweep a finger in the mouth. You risk pressing the blockage deeper. I have seen that error twice in my job, and both times it turned a convenient situation into an even worse one.
Burns in your home and in the backyard
Most pediatric burns originate from hot fluids and surfaces, not open flames. The most effective treatment is additionally the easiest. Cool the location under delicately running amazing water for 20 mins. Not 5, not 10. Twenty mins. The science supports it: long term air conditioning lowers cells damages, discomfort, and scarring. Eliminate jewelry and clothing around the shed unless it is stuck. Do not apply ice, toothpaste, butter, or creams. After cooling down, cover with a non-stick clothing or clean cling wrap. Seek treatment if the melt is bigger than the child's palm, involves the face, hands, feet, genital areas, or goes across a joint, or if it blisters extensively.

Fevers, febrile seizures, and what not to fear
A high fever looks frightening yet is usually an indication the immune system is functioning. The number on the thermostat matters less than just how the kid appears. If they are consuming, sharp, and breathing easily, you have time. Paracetamol or ibuprofen can reduce discomfort, however neither stops febrile seizures.
If a seizure takes place, time it, relocate close by threats away, put the youngster on their side, and do not place anything in the mouth. Most febrile seizures last under 5 mins. Call triple no if it continues longer than 5 mins, if breathing seems damaged, or if it is the youngster's initial seizure. Asthma and breathing concerns throughout sport or play
Campbelltown winters can be completely dry and first aid certification course springtime brings plant pollen. Asthma flares, particularly during sport, are common. The activity plan is clear: sit the youngster upright, provide 4 puffs of a reliever inhaler using a spacer if available, one puff each time with 4 breaths between each smoke. Wait 4 minutes. If there is no enhancement, repeat. If still not improving, call three-way no and continue doses every 4 minutes. If the kid has an anaphylaxis danger, reward that initially with an adrenaline autoinjector if signs and symptoms point to an allergic reaction.

Allergies, anaphylaxis, and reviewing the room
Food-centric occasions drive lots of allergies. Anaphylaxis generally shows as combinations of swelling, hives, throwing up, breathing difficulty, throat rigidity, dizziness, or sudden collapse. If you are even reasonably suspicious, use the adrenaline autoinjector. Do not wait for an excellent verification. Lay the kid level or keep them in a setting of comfort if breathing is hard. Utilize a 2nd autoinjector after 5 to 10 mins if symptoms continue. Call triple no and do not let the kid stand up instantly, because that can worsen blood pressure collapse.

Head knocks, neck discomfort, and when to rest tight
Kids hit their heads. Most are minor. Warning include loss of consciousness, duplicated throwing up, worsening frustration, complication, sleepiness you can not wake from, seizures, blood or clear fluid from the ear or nose, and weak point or pins and needles in arm or legs. If any one of these appear, seek immediate medical aid. Keep the kid still, support the head if neck injury is feasible, and stay clear of unnecessary motion. If they look out and improving, enjoy them at home yet maintain psychological notes concerning actions. A youngster who is quieter than usual or off equilibrium hours later on deserves a medical check.

Poisonings, medicines, and the bottle that appeared like juice
Household cleaners, medications, and cosmetics are common wrongdoers. If a youngster ingests something, do not induce throwing up. Check the label, clean the mouth, and call the Poisons Details Centre for guidance. If the kid breaks down, has breathing issues, or reveals severe symptoms, call triple absolutely no. Save the container for paramedics. On the prevention side, maintain original child-safe packaging, and shop medicines hidden and reach, not just over youngster elevation but in secured or latched cabinets.

Bleeding and cuts: pressure and patience
For most cuts, use company direct pressure with a tidy towel or clothing, raise ideally, and hold that pressure. Glance less. Continuous pressure builds clotting. If blood soaks through, layer much more dressing on the top. For nosebleeds, pinch the pulp of the nose and lean the head a little forward for 10 mins without releasing. Do not turn the head back, which can send out blood right into the throat. Seek care for deep wounds, consistent blood loss after 20 minutes of stress, or any type of cut that gapes sufficient to require closing.

Legal and moral basics every carer ought to know
Act within your degree of training and do the best good you can. If a kid is conscious, clarify what you are performing in straightforward terms. For another person's child, get authorization from a parent or guardian when possible, yet in a life-threatening circumstance, the legislation identifies suggested approval. Keep notes after substantial occasions, particularly for school or club settings, and hand them to the liable party. Updates to standards and guidelines roll out regularly, so intend on a refresh cycle for your abilities and knowledge.
